How Dr Dre Built His Fortune
Dr Dre net worth traces back to his early career as a rapper and producer with N.W.A, then solo albums such as The Chronic and 2001 that generated massive royalties. He founded Aftermath Entertainment in 1996 and signed artists including Eminem, whose albums became some of the best selling in history. These music catalog rights remain a steady income source and are a large part of his net worth according to Forbes.
Dr Dre co-founded Beats Electronics with Jimmy Iovine in 2006, building headphones and audio products that later attracted a buyout from Apple. The Apple acquisition of Beats in 2014 for 3 billion dollars is the single largest transaction linked to his wealth, and Apple has not disclosed Beats specific financials publicly. Forbes notes that the deal made Dr Dre one of the wealthiest figures in hip hop and cemented his role in consumer audio and streaming.
